Chief Justice reviews functioning, infrastructure of District Court Complex Ganderbal
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

GANDERBAL: Chief Justice High Court, Jammu & Kashmir and Ladakh, Justice N. Kotiswar Singh, today visited the District Court Complex Ganderbal and reviewed the functioning of the court besides taking stock of infrastructural facilities there.

Chief Justice was accompanied by Justice Moksha Khajuria Kazmi, Administrative Judge District Court Ganderbal.

On arrival, Chief Justice was given a guard of honor by District Police Ganderbal.

Chief Justice and Justice Moksha Khajuria Kazmi visited all courtrooms and observed the proceedings of cases. They also visited the office of the District Legal Services Authority, Ganderbal, and the front office of DLSA Ganderbal, and gave certain on spot directions to Judicial Officers and Police Department.

While interacting with the Judicial Officers and Administrative Officers, Chief Justice said that the purpose of visiting this district court complex was to assess the basic infrastructure issues here as courts are important public institutions and need basic facilities including courtrooms, enhanced e-court facilities, facilities for lawyers, public and litigants to function properly. He issued several directions for further streamlining infrastructural facilities in the court.

Chief Justice also reviewed the progress on land acquisition for the new Court Complex.

Deputy Commissioner Ganderbal informed the Chief Justice that 40 kanal of land has already been identified and will be transferred after the completion of codal formalities.

Chief Justice directed the Chief Engineer, R&B to keep DPR ready as per the revenue site plan so that work on the new Court complex could be started at the earliest once land gets transferred to the law department.

Later, the Chief Justice and Administrative Judge of District Ganderbal, chaired a separate meeting of District Bar Association Ganderbal who apprised them of several issues confronting them while discharging their legitimate duties and the Chief Justice has assured them all genuine issues will be looked into priority.

Shahzad Azeem, Registrar General, High Court of J&K and Ladakh, M.K Sharma, Principal Secretary to Chief Justice, Ritesh Kumar Dubey, Principal District and Sessions Judge Ganderbal, Farooq Ahmad Bhat, Registrar Judicial Srinagar, Rafiq Ahmad Rafiq, Chief Engineer, R&B, Shayimbir Singh, Deputy Commissioner Ganderbal, Judicial Officers, Nikhil Borkar, SP Ganderbal, civil officers and Bar Members were also present.
